The Best Eggs Benedict at Glo's Coffee House

On a Saturday morning, I purposefully woke up a little bit earlier to try this well reviewed restaurant in Capitol Hill, Glo's. My favorite thing to do on a Saturday morning is trying new breakfast places with friends or just by myself. Glo's was best reviewed for their Eggs Benedict. It's a small restaurant with an excellent service. The turn table at that restaurant is quite amazing, simply there is no empty table at all. We waited for almost 20 minutes to be seated. I asked one of the customers that was waiting outside with me if this was her first visit to Glo's, her answer was, "I've been here so many times, and the food has always been so satisfying. Just look at the place, it's tiny, but a lot of people don't mind waiting for a long time, so the food must be GOOD!"...

Soon enough after waiting outside in a cold, snowy weather, me and my boyfriend went in to be seated, we ordered Salmon Eggs Benedict, Black Bean Omelette, and their famous Sour Cream Coffee Cake. They only had two chef's in their tiny kitchen to serve the whole restaurant, the wait was a little bit long.

When the food came and we had our first bite- Oh My!.... The wait was worth it... Each bite was so good, it melts in the mouth so smoothly and perfectly. The Smoked Salmon Eggs Benedict was simply the best. English Muffin at the bottom, layered with fresh Smoked Salmon, top with poached eggs smothered with Benedict sauce, and a small tiny slice of olive- was so perfect and good. It was served with a side of Hashbrown and a slice of grapefruit. This dish was definitely to die for. In a second, we forgot how long we've waited in the cold weather.

I can tell you in a long page how the omelette taste and the Sour Cream Coffee cake, but I've got to share with you Seattleites' Diary readers, if you have never tried Glo's - You have got to try this wonderful local eatery at Capitol Hill anytime soon! You will not regret it.

Glo's is located at:

1621 E Olive Way | Seattle, WA 98102

They open from 7am-3pm Mon-Fri, and until 4pm - Sat through Sunday.
